18"""Python support for DisOrder
19
20Provides disorder.client, a class for accessing a DisOrder server.
21
22Example 1:
23
24 #! /usr/bin/env python
25 import disorder
26 d = disorder.client()
27 p = d.playing()
28 if p:
29 print p['track']
30
31Example 2:
32
33 #! /usr/bin/env python
34 import disorder
35 import sys
36 d = disorder.client()
37 for path in sys.argv[1:]:
38 d.play(path)
39
79cbb91d
RK
40See disorder_protocol(5) for details of the communication protocol.
41
42NB that this code only supports servers configured to use SHA1-based
43authentication. If the server demands another hash then it will not be
44possible to use this module.

249class client:
250 """DisOrder client class.
251
252 This class provides access to the DisOrder server either on this
253 machine or across the internet.
254
255 The server to connect to, and the username and password to use, are
256 determined from the configuration files as described in 'man
257 disorder_config'.
258
259 All methods will connect if necessary, as soon as you have a
260 disorder.client object you can start calling operational methods on
261 it.
262
263 However if the server is restarted then the next method called on a
264 connection will throw an exception. This may be considered a bug.
265
266 All methods block until they complete.
267
268 Operation methods raise communicationError if the connection breaks,
269 protocolError if the response from the server is malformed, or
270 operationError if the response is valid but indicates that the
271 operation failed.
272 """
